remote
Product, Platform & Enterprise Front End Software Engineer II Remote - BNSF Railway
Software Engineer
Remote Front End Engineer II focused on building scalable, high‑performance web applications for product, platform, and enterprise solutions using React, TypeScript, and modern web technologies.
About the role
Key Responsibilities
- Design, develop, and maintain responsive web applications using React, TypeScript, HTML5, and CSS.
- Collaborate with product owners, UX designers, and backend teams to translate requirements into clean, reusable code.
- Integrate RESTful APIs and services, ensuring optimal performance and reliability.
- Implement automated testing, CI/CD pipelines, and code review processes to uphold code quality.
- Participate in Agile ceremonies, contribute to sprint planning, and continuously improve development workflows.
Requirements
- 3+ years of professional front‑end development experience with React and TypeScript.
- Strong proficiency in JavaScript, HTML5, and CSS (including modern layout techniques).
- Experience consuming REST APIs and working with version control (Git).
- Familiarity with CI/CD tools (e.g., Jenkins, GitHub Actions) and automated testing frameworks.
- Ability to work effectively in a remote, collaborative, Agile environment.
Skills
reacttypescriptjavascriptcicdagile